America’s Spanish Revival architectural movement of the 1920s left us remarkable structures heavily influenced by the world of al-Andalus. We will travel by bus to explore beautiful examples in Houston. Tour followed by a wine and tapas reception.
Stephen Fox, Architectural Historian
Stephen Fox is a fellow of the Anchorage Foundation of Texas and teaches architectural history at Rice University and University of Houston. He is widely published and the author of "The Country Houses of John Staub" and co-author of the noted "Galveston Architectural Guidebook" with Ellen Beasley. Anchorage Foundation
